03How Other Mandis Compare Today
The table below lines up Firewood rates across the markets that reported on 02 Jul 2026, so you can see where Tilhar APMC sits versus the rest. A clear front-runner tends to shape what nearby yards quote.
| Mandi | Price (₹ / quintal) |
|---|---|
| 1 Hapur APMC Leader | ₹735 |
| 2 Tilhar APMC | ₹700 |
| 3 Madhogarh APMC | ₹600 |
| 4 Jasra APMC | ₹600 |
| 5 Kosikalan APMC | ₹575 |
| 6 Pukharayan APMC | ₹550 |
| 7 Rura APMC | ₹548 |
| 8 Hardoi APMC | ₹540 |
| 9 Mohammdi APMC | ₹520 |
| 10 Jalaun APMC | ₹500 |
| 11 Gurusarai APMC | ₹500 |
| 12 Madhoganj APMC | ₹500 |
